Responsibilities
- Utilize documentation and personal experience to cultivate a thorough technical understanding, perform detailed assessments, and document issues, risks, and reports in line with established standards and best practices
- Comprehend work processes and methodologies, best practices, NASA standards, and applicable system and software specifications
- Evaluate developmental artifacts for accuracy, completeness, consistency, ambiguity, and feasibility concerning technical references when reviewing requirements, design, algorithms, code, and testing artifacts throughout the software development life cycle
- Conduct analysis on draft and final products submitted for peer reviews, development build releases, and formal testing
- Aid in the creation and execution of independent test scenarios and procedures to confirm the accurate implementation of mission-critical functionalities
- Employ in-house developed AI-assisted analysis tools to conduct various evaluations and assess results for true positive findings
- Collaborate effectively with team members to foster team dynamics, brainstorm, share knowledge, refine approaches, conduct peer reviews, and provide recommendations that enhance growth and confidence in IV&V analyses
